logo

Output e39133d529051240be16d32929a655e310f1ec9e04c7fb1579b8bdc1879f7536:0

value
26133198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b0ded8e7e163e91e3125b96fc9f290f7812089 OP_EQUAL
address
3Lu3i1HY8y17x8FHWNc5sMa4aWbmdh3NDC
transaction
e39133d529051240be16d32929a655e310f1ec9e04c7fb1579b8bdc1879f7536